These non-chlorine products make water feel soft to the skin, eyes and hair. Can my pool water be sanitized without chlorine? Yes, chlorine is not the only sanitizer that can be used to treat pool water.

Your pump helps circulate the shock around the pool water to do its job. Without …

WebA non-chlorine shock is sometimes called the “shock and swim” method because it’s safe to swim after about 15 minutes. Does Shocking Your Pool Kill Algae?
